Abstract

Mobile phones have become increasingly widespread, affecting communication in both positive and negative ways in relationships. One such negative effect is "phubbing," where one partner ignores the other in favour of their phone, potentially undermining relationship satisfaction. This study examines the impact of partner phubbing on romantic relationship satisfaction, with a focus on the moderating role of attachment style. Data were collected through an online survey using the Generic Scale of Being Phubbed, the Relationship Assessment Scale, and the Experiences in Close Relationships Revised Scale. A total of 531 participants were involved, meeting the following criteria: (a) aged 18 and above, (b) in a romantic relationship (dating or married) for at least one year, (c) with a partner who has access to a mobile phone, and (d) not in a long-distance relationship. The results indicate that partner phubbing significantly predicts lower relationship satisfaction. Additionally, avoidant attachment style moderates this relationship, while anxious attachment does not significantly affect the relationship between phubbing and satisfaction. These findings suggest that partner phubbing negatively impacts relationship satisfaction, with attachment style— particularly avoidant attachment—playing a key role in this dynamic. / Telepon seluler kini semakin luas penggunaannya dan memengaruhi komunikasi dalam hubungan, baik secara positif maupun negatif. Salah satu dampak negatifnya adalah "phubbing", yaitu perilaku di mana salah satu pasangan mengabaikan pasangannya demi ponsel, yang dapat merusak kepuasan hubungan.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engkaji dampak perilaku phubbing pasangan terhadap kepuasan hubungan romantis, dengan fokus pada peran moderasi gaya kelekatan. Data dikumpulkan melalui survei online menggunakan Generic Scale of Being Phubbed, Relationship Assessment Scale, dan Experiences in Close Relationships Revised Scale. Sebanyak 531 partisipan terlibat dalam penelitian ini, dengan kriteria sebagai berikut: (a) berusia 18 tahun ke atas, (b) berada dalam hubungan romantis (berpacaran atau menikah) selama minimal satu tahun, (c) memiliki pasangan yang dapat mengakses telepon seluler, dan (d) tidak dalam hubungan jarak jauh.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a perilaku phubbing pasangan secara signifikan memprediksi penurunan kepuasan hubungan (F(1, 529) = 140.911, p < 0.05). Selain itu, gaya kelekatan avoidant memoderasi hubungan ini (F(1, 527) = 30.366, p = 0.000), sementara gaya kelekatan anxious tidak mempengaruhi hubungan antara phubbing dan kepuasan secara signifikan (F(1, 527) = 0.215, p = 0.643). Temuan ini menunjukkan bahwa perilaku phubbing pasangan berdampak negatif terhadap kepuasan hubungan, dengan gaya kelekatan—terutama gaya kelekatan avoidant—berperan penting dalam dinamika ini.
